What are the responsibilities and job description for the Fire Technician position at Schmidt Security Pro?
Job Overview:
This service/inspector position performs inspection, testing, and maintenance on fire sprinkler systems and other water-based systems in accordance with all national and local standards.
Job Responsibilities Include:
Provide inspection, testing, and service for sprinkler systems, kitchen hood suppression systems, backflow systems, fire alarm and other fire protection systems- Complete required documentation including deficiency repair recommendations
- Discuss noted deficiencies with customers as well as remedies and corrective actions
- Follow and maintain highly structured inspection schedules
- Maintain complete and accurate documentation of all tests performed.
- Complete service ticket documentation as well as inspection reports before leaving customer site
- Provide instructions to customer personnel regarding proper operations and routine inspections and assist with training
- Work overtime when needed
- Adhere to local, corporate, and OSHA safety policies and procedures
- Complete required training and certifications within the time requirements for this role
- Provide hands-on training and coaching of entry level inspectors
- Maintain vehicles stock, tools, and equipment.
- Follow corporate policies related to vehicle use and care.
Qualifications:
High school diploma or GED required- Minimum 2 years’ experience performing Inspections, Testing, and Maintenance (ITM) of Fire Sprinkler and/or Fire Life Safety Systems; 5 years for Senior level.
- Ability to read and understand design and construction documents required
- Must be able to use hand tools, laptop, email, smartphone, and tablet
- Must be able to carry and move equipment and tools weighing up to 75 pounds unassisted
- Ability to work in a team environment providing support to our customers
